Empire State Building And Statue Of Liberty
Iconic landmarks in New York City.
The Empire State Building and the Statue of Liberty are two iconic landmarks located in New York City, USA. The Empire State Building is a 102-story skyscraper completed in 1931, renowned for its Art Deco architecture and historical significance during the Great Depression era. It held the title of the world's tallest building until 1972 and remains one of New York City’s most recognizable symbols. The Statue of Liberty, a colossal neoclassical sculpture completed in 1886, symbolizes freedom and democracy. A gift from France to the United States, it has welcomed millions of immigrants arriving by sea and continues to serve as a powerful emblem of American ideals.
